Psalm 57:11(10) For Your lovingkindness is great up to the heavens, and Your truth to the skies. 12(11) Be exalted, O God, above the heavens. Let Your glory be over all the earth!

Today, we finish Psalm 57 with a flourish of praise for God, “Your lovingkindness” (Chas’d’cha), “Your truth” (Ami’te’cha), “Be exalted” (Rumah), “Your glory” (K’vod’e’cha).  That’s some high praise, and look where it is being offered: “to the heavens” (Sha’ma’yim), to the skies (Sh’chaq’im), “Above the heavens” (Al-Sha’ma’yim), “Over the entire earth” (Kol-Ha’A’retz).  I’d say that pretty much covers every possibility.

This idea of proactively carrying the message of God to the world is not new to David… Psalm 18:50 Therefore I praise You among the nations, Adonai, and sing praises to Your Name. 51 Great victories He gives to His king. He shows loyal love to His anointed—to David and his seed, forever.  This is a message that defines David’s life (and our own) in Messiah Yeshua for eternity (in both space and time).  Paul’s prayer is for us today….
